Study of influence of superimposed hydrostatic pressure on bendability of sheet metals

Abstract

The effect of superimposed hydrostatic pressure on the bendability of sheet metal is investigated using the finite element method employing the Gurson-Tvergaard-Needleman (GTN) model.
